No Ransom is a 1934 American film directed by Fred C. Newmeyer.[1]

Plot
editNo Ransom film directed by Fred C. Newmeyer in 1934. This comedy-drama is about a husband and a father to two kids. His son is described as a deadbeat, his wild daughter, and his controlling, strict wife are all very unappreciative of what he does for the family. John Winfeild (The main protaganist) is a wealthy executive for a steel company. He hires a hitman to kill him. Instead of killing him the gunman kidnaps him and then forces his family to be appreciative.
